Soffit Board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
Soffit boards play a critical function in the structure and maintenance of a home's outside. Located beneath the eaves of your roofing, they serve as both a decorative and practical element, aiding with ventilation and protecting against bugs. Over time, exposure to the aspects can lead to harm, requiring repairs or replacement. This article offers an extensive take a look at soffit board repair, covering typical problems, products required, detailed repair directions, and often asked concerns.
Understanding Soffit Boards
Before diving into repair techniques, it's necessary to understand what soffit boards are and their function.
What Are Soffit Boards?
Soffit boards cover the eaves of your roofing and are normally made from materials such as wood, vinyl, or aluminum. Their main roles include:
- Ventilation: Allowing airflow into the attic area to avoid mold and heat accumulation.
- Bug deterrent: Acting as a barrier versus pests and rodents.
- Aesthetic appeal: Enhancing the home's appearance by supplying a finished seek to the eaves.
Common Issues with Soffit Boards
Soffit boards can deal with different issues in time. Understanding these problems is crucial for reliable repair.
| Problem | Description |
|---|---|
| Water Damage | Triggered by leakages or poor drain that results in mold and rot. |
| Pest Infestation | Bugs or rodents can damage the board and Fascias And Soffits weaken its structural integrity. |
| Physical Damage | Effects from storms or falling branches can lead to cracks or breaks. |
| Fade and Discoloration | Direct exposure to sunshine and weather condition can cause fading and peeling. |

Step-by-Step Guide for Soffit Board Repair
Repairing soffit boards can be a workable task when following a systematic technique.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Step 1: Inspection
Begin by examining the soffit boards for any indications of damage or moisture. Search for:
- Rot or soft areas
- Noticeable insect holes or nests
- Fractures or breaks
If damage is discovered, note the locations that require repair or replacement.
Step 2: Gather Materials
As soon as you've recognized the areas needing repair, gather the needed materials and tools from the lists provided above.
Action 3: Remove Damaged Sections
Using a lever and hammer, thoroughly eliminate the damaged soffit boards. Take care to prevent destructive nearby boards or the underlying structure. If you're handling vinyl or aluminum, an energy knife can in some cases assist to cut through.
Step 4: Prepare for Installation
If you discovered rot within the framework beneath the soffit boards, it's essential to Fascia Repair this location before proceeding. For wooden structures, utilize wood filler to fix any holes or develop a smoother surface. Make sure that the location is clean and dry.
Step 5: Install New Soffit Boards
Cut the Replacement Boards: Measure and cut your new soffit boards to fit the openings. Idea: Allow for expansion gaps if you're using a material like vinyl, which might expand throughout temperature modifications.
Attach: Roofline Services Position the boards fascia and soffit maintenance secure them utilizing screws or nails, depending on the product. Guarantee they are flush with the existing boards for a cohesive appearance.
Action 6: Seal and Paint
Once installed, use caulk or weather sealant along the edges to avoid wetness entry. If you are working with wooden boards, consider painting or staining them to match your home and include protection versus the aspects.
Action 7: Final Inspection
After finishing the installation and sealing, carry out a last assessment. Look for any spaces or areas needing touch-ups, and make sure whatever is securely in place.
Step 8: Clean Up
Remove any particles from the workspace and shop tools properly.
FAQs About Soffit Board Repair
1. How can I inform if my soffit boards need repair?
Indications of damage consist of visible fractures, water stains, mold development, drooping boards, or indications of bug infestation.
2. Can I repair soffit boards myself?
Yes! With basic tools and materials, lots of property owners can handle small repairs. However, for comprehensive damage, it might be Best Fascia Replacement to consult a professional.
3. What products should I utilize for soffit repairs?
Typical materials include wood for traditional homes, vinyl for low maintenance, and aluminum for durability. Pick based on your home's design and your spending plan.
4. How can I avoid future soffit board damage?
Routine examinations, guaranteeing correct attic ventilation, and dealing with any wetness problems immediately will assist keep the stability of your soffit boards.

5. How frequently should I inspect my soffit boards?
It's recommended to perform a visual assessment at least once a year, particularly before winter and after major storms.
